16. ritten SNR is a measure of signal strength relative to background noise The ratio is usually measured in decibels dB In digital communications the SNR will probably cause a reduction in data speed because of frequent errors that require the source transmitting computer or terminal to resend some packets of data SNR measures the quality of a transmission channel over a network channel The greater the ratio the easier it is to identify and subsequently isolate and eliminate the source of noise Generally speaking the higher SNR value gets better line quality but lower performance What is band plan and what s the effect VDSL2 defines multiple band plans and configuration modes profiles to allow asymmetric and symmetric services in the same binder by designated frequency bands for the transmission of upstream and downstream signals User has the ability to select fixed band plan When Symmetric is selected that provides better downstream performance when Asymmetric is selected that provides better upstream performance
